Abstract
A composite hydrophilic membrane comprising a very thin semipermeable hydrophilic membrane containing a sulfonic group and a polyethylenic microporous membrane containing sulfonic group. This hydrophilic membrane has specially high permeation rate of water and excellent separation ability. The composite hydrophilic membrane is manufactured by a method which comprises fusing a very thin membrane containing an ethylenic copolymer onto the surface of a polyethylenic microporous membrane or a polyethylenic membrane capable of being converted into a microporous membrane thereby forming a composite film, converting the resin film prior to and/or during and/or after sulfonation into a microporous membrane, and causing the composite film to react with a sulfonating agent. This method permits easy and efficient production of the composite hydrophilic membrane.
